Output 70eddf926c3ddc8c0df43decd315552432f3cae937410e166bbff8393b8c0a9e:0

value
39384640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950ec7c3fb2502f9463f5f27951158a3d6b823ec OP_EQUAL
address
3FHAK5iU8ioXmQKU8uNPayuQwZ7V9zaMZw
transaction
70eddf926c3ddc8c0df43decd315552432f3cae937410e166bbff8393b8c0a9e
spent
true